Ep 5 - Surviving
10 sept. 2026
00:34:50
The episode features a conversation with Tamara, who shares her experience of multiple losses, including the loss of her husband and father in a short span of time. She discusses her journey of grief, coping mechanisms, and the decision to pursue a career in psychotherapy. The hosts also reflect on their own experiences of grief and the importance of finding support and healing.

In this episode, Lorna shares her heartfelt journey through her husband's battle with leukemia, the emotional rollercoaster of hope and loss, and her inspiring campaign to encourage blood donation in his memory. Discover how resilience, purpose, and community support can help navigate grief and turn tragedy into hope.
